Torres vs Lower Hutt, Avalon Climate & Distance Between

New Zealand flag
  • The distance between Torres, Brazil and Lower Hutt, Avalon, New Zealand is approximately 10,927 km or 6,790 mi.
  • To reach Torres in this distance one would set out from Lower Hutt, Avalon bearing 141.7° or SE and follow the great circles arc to approach Torres bearing 32.3° or NNE .
  • Torres has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Lower Hutt, Avalon has a marine west coast climate (Cfb).
  • Torres is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ome whereas Lower Hutt, Avalon is in or near the warm temperate thorn steppe biome.
  • The annual average temperature is 5.8 °C (10.4°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 0.5 °C (0.9°F) less in Torres.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ic for both.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 42.8 mm (1.7 in) more which is equivalent to 42.8 l/m² (1.05 US gal/ft²) or 428,000 l/ha (45,756 US gal/ac) more. About 1 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 11.8° higher in Torres than in Lower Hutt, Avalon.
